1. Advances in Mobile Technology: The Rise of the Smartphone
While smartphones weren't new in 2012, this year marked significant advancements in their capabilities and accessibility. The release of the iPhone 5, with its improved screen and faster processor, and the continued evolution of Android devices, solidified the smartphone's role as a central hub for communication, information, and entertainment. Improved mobile internet speeds also played a crucial role, enabling more seamless streaming and mobile application usage. This wasn't a single invention, but a culmination of improvements in various components – processors, displays, battery technology, and network infrastructure – that collectively propelled mobile technology to new heights.
2. The Expanding World of Big Data and Cloud Computing
2012 saw a continued expansion of big data analytics and cloud computing capabilities. Companies like Amazon, Google, and Microsoft further refined their cloud services, making them more accessible and affordable for businesses and individuals. This enabled the storage and processing of massive datasets, leading to advancements in machine learning, artificial intelligence, and data-driven decision-making across various sectors. While not a specific invention, the increased sophistication and accessibility of cloud infrastructure was a pivotal development in 2012.
3. Progress in 3D Printing Technology
3D printing technology, while not entirely new, experienced significant advancements in 2012. Improvements in printing speed, material diversity, and software capabilities broadened its applications. This year saw an increase in the accessibility of 3D printers for both consumers and businesses, fostering innovation in design, prototyping, and manufacturing across numerous industries, from healthcare to aerospace. The evolution of 3D printing wasn't a single invention but rather a convergence of improvements in materials science, software algorithms, and hardware engineering.
